January 05, 1943 - July 23, 2016
LASH, William James - (Age 73) William "Bill" James Lash, of Spokane succumbed to cancer on Saturday July 23, 2016. He was born January 5, 1943 to William and Edna Lash. - He worked as a baker for Wonder Bread Hostess for over 25 years. He served in the Army Air Force National Guard where he was recognized for Aviation and as a Rifle Marksman. We can proudly say he made a lasting impression on everyone he met with his charm and amusing personality. He enjoyed watching John Wayne Westerns and listening to Elvis Presley, playing Santa Clause at Christmas time for the kids and spending time with family and friends. - William was preceded in death by his grandparents; his parents and sister, Maureen Lash. He is survived by his son Guy (William) Lash; and many loving grandchildren, nieces, nephews and extended family. William was a loving father, grandfather and friend to all. - A special thank you to the Hospice House in Spokane for their loving care and support.
